Transaction f98c56f3a7e456310f6ab3fc70d0e7c2ead3c7617b661644ab999d70d9a8057e
1 Input
2 Outputs
- f98c56f3a7e456310f6ab3fc70d0e7c2ead3c7617b661644ab999d70d9a8057e:0
- f98c56f3a7e456310f6ab3fc70d0e7c2ead3c7617b661644ab999d70d9a8057e:1
value 589093
address 3PPghPCv9rqRgC7hhHXfyp4fzSfmkvAroh
value 1442377
address 1DWPb5mevprRA6mmqKMWVz2bUbKsiSpsTC